Wefarm: Funding, Investors & Team (Sep 2026)

Wefarm is a farmer-to-farmer digital network that enables farmers to share information via SMS. The company allows small-scale farmers to connect with one another to solve problems, share ideas, and spread innovation. Utilizing the latest machine learning technology, Wefarm’s service works both online and over SMS. Since its founding in 2015, Wefarm has been named one of Africa’s Most Innovative Companies by FastCompany and has won Google’s Impact Challenge Award, TechCrunch’s Europas-Tech for Good Award, and the European Union Commission’s Ideas from Europe prize, among others. The company is headquartered in London with a field presence in Nairobi, Kampala, and Dar-es-Salaam.

Wefarm has raised $11.0M across 1 funding round on record, the most recent a Series A of $11.0M announced in Mar 2021.

That round is above the $3.3M median round size for Agriculture and Farming companies tracked on FundedIQ over the last two years.
